Which scenario would likely use a long-residual pesticide?

Explanation:
Long-residual pesticides are used when pests persist over time and ongoing protection is needed without frequent reapplication. In settings like livestock buildings or termite control, pest pressure is constant or re-entry from the outside is likely, so a product that remains effective after application helps keep pests suppressed for weeks or months and reduces the need for repeated spraying. This makes it the best fit for situations where you’re dealing with ongoing problems and want lasting protection. Outdoor flowering plant treatments are usually chosen for quick knockdown with limited lasting effect, to protect pollinators and avoid unnecessary residues. A home interior spot-treatment targets a localized, short-term problem, and a pesticide with no residual offers no lasting protection, which isn’t suitable for ongoing issues.
